UK-Ugandan based musician Wildive thrills fans at the hit-after-hit concert in London

BY PAUL IBANDA

UK-Ugandan based dance hall artiste George Wildive real names George Galiwango who is also a singer at North Pole entertainment crew left revelers at the hit-after-hit concert unsatisfied as majority of the partiers continuously demanded for more of his performances.

The concert was held at Royal Regency manor park London recently.George Wildive who represented UK-Uganda based finest Artistes fulfilled the concert’s title ‘hit after hit’ sooner than later after stepping stage.

George Wildive thrills fans during the concert.

He performed right from his first songs including MBs, Banakyeeyo, Nabuwalala to his latest tune titled Wansi w’omuti. At the concert, majority of the fans danced to the tunes of his late song wansi w’omuti that has similarly received massive attention with in the local industry and across all media platforms globally.

The concert was headlined by Uganda’s finest Dr. Jose Chameleon and Juliana Kanyomozi who also sang their hearts out and had to leave partiers letting out oooos and aaaas.the concert was organized by Jose Jobs Link UK.

Who is George Wildive

George Wildive born George William Galiwango 29 years ago is a former Uganda Cranes footballer and recording artiste in the United Kingdom. He started his music career in 2014. He is best known for his love ballad Nabuwalala and Tulibakowu.

George Wildive sings his heart out during the concert. Courtesy photo.

George Wildive is considered a great performer who is very influential among his fans.  He is said to be the most loved and decorated Ugandan artiste in The Diaspora at the moment and also doubles as an astute businessman.

Back home, George is a resident of Zana along Entebbe at North Pole music offices. Wansi w’omuti is his latest song with its video out on all media handles.
